Clearing vs. Grubbing vs. Excavation vs. Grading: What Each Scope Includes
Clearing, grubbing, excavation and grading are related, but they are not interchangeable terms. Treating them as synonyms is one of the easiest ways to create a scope gap between the clearing crew, dirt contractor and next trade.
Clearing
Clearing generally removes trees, brush and above-ground vegetation from defined limits. The handling of logs, chips and vegetative debris should be stated separately because disposal method can materially affect cost and production.
Grubbing
Grubbing addresses stumps, roots and organic material below grade. The required treatment depends on what will be built next. A wooded area left in a natural condition does not require the same below-grade preparation as a roadway, building pad or utility corridor.
Excavation
Excavation removes or relocates soil and other material to reach required grades, construct trenches or create site features. Excavation scope should identify quantities or the basis of estimate, unsuitable material assumptions, haul requirements and whether material stays on site or leaves the project.
Grading
Grading shapes the site to the elevations and tolerances required by the plans and the next construction activity. Rough grading, fine grading and final stabilization are different levels of completion, so the proposal should identify which condition is included.
How the Scopes Work Together
A typical sequence may be clearing, grubbing, erosion-control installation, bulk excavation, rough grading, utility-related earthwork, fine grading and stabilization. The exact sequence depends on the plans and GC schedule. Defining each handoff keeps a later trade from discovering that the surface it expected was never part of the earlier contractor's scope.
Questions to Put in the Bid Documents
What are the exact work limits?
Are stumps removed, ground or left outside improvement areas?
Where do logs, chips, spoil and unsuitable material go?
What earthwork quantities control the bid?
Who furnishes imported material and permanent materials?
What grade or stabilization condition is required at handoff?
